Firefox crashing

Gianluca Sforna giallu at gmail.com
Fri May 23 09:02:57 UTC 2008


It seems that I can consistently crash my Firefox
(firefox-3.0-0.60.beta5.fc9.x86_64) just by fast switching between
tabs.

If I run firefox from the console I get:

which: no soundwrapper in
(/usr/lib64/qt-3.3/bin:/usr/kerberos/bin:/usr/lib64/ccache:/usr/local/bin:/usr/bin:/bin:/sbin:/home/giallu/bin:/usr/sbin)
which: no soundwrapper in
(/usr/lib64/qt-3.3/bin:/usr/kerberos/bin:/usr/lib64/ccache:/usr/local/bin:/usr/bin:/bin:/sbin:/home/giallu/bin:/usr/sbin)
Gtk-Message: Failed to load module "gnomebreakpad":
libgnomebreakpad.so: cannot open shared object file: No such file or
directory

(npviewer.bin:22267): Gtk-WARNING **: Unable to locate theme engine in
module_path: "nodoka",

(npviewer.bin:22267): Gtk-WARNING **: Unable to locate theme engine in
module_path: "nodoka",
/usr/lib64/firefox-3.0b5/run-mozilla.sh: line 131: 22212 Segmentation
fault      (core dumped) "$prog" ${1+"$@"}

and I've got some gdb backtrace (I can give more if needed):

Program received signal SIGSEGV, Segmentation fault.
js_GetStringBytes (cx=<value optimized out>, str=<value optimized out>)
    at jsstr.c:3207
3207	    if (!rt->deflatedStringCacheLock) {
(gdb) bt
#0  js_GetStringBytes (cx=<value optimized out>, str=<value optimized out>)
    at jsstr.c:3207
#1  0x0000003ccd6171ed in JS_GetStringBytes (str=<value optimized out>)
    at jsapi.c:5304
#2  0x000000337c2b849e in jsdScript (this=<value optimized out>,
    aCx=<value optimized out>, aScript=<value optimized out>)
    at jsd_xpc.cpp:992
#3  0x000000337c2b9c4f in jsdScript::FromPtr (aCx=<value optimized out>,
    aScript=<value optimized out>) at jsd_xpc.h:155
#4  0x000000337c2b86fc in jsdService::EnumerateScripts (
    this=<value optimized out>, enumerator=<value optimized out>)
    at jsd_xpc.cpp:2712
#5  0x000000337c421fd4 in NS_InvokeByIndex_P (that=<value optimized out>,
    methodIndex=<value optimized out>, paramCount=<value optimized out>,
    params=<value optimized out>) at xptcinvoke_x86_64_linux.cpp:208
#6  0x000000337bc4b4ef in XPCWrappedNative::CallMethod (
    ccx=<value optimized out>, mode=<value optimized out>)
    at xpcwrappednative.cpp:2369
#7  0x000000337bc53c0b in XPC_WN_CallMethod (cx=<value optimized out>,
    obj=<value optimized out>, argc=<value optimized out>,
    argv=<value optimized out>, vp=<value optimized out>)
    at xpcwrappednativejsops.cpp:1470
#8  0x0000003ccd64bf17 in js_Invoke (cx=<value optimized out>,
---Type <return> to continue, or q <return> to quit---
    argc=<value optimized out>, vp=<value optimized out>,
    flags=<value optimized out>) at jsinterp.c:1287
#9  0x0000003ccd63f258 in js_Interpret (cx=0x36a35f0) at jsinterp.c:4841
#10 0x0000003ccd64bf7f in js_Invoke (cx=<value optimized out>,
    argc=<value optimized out>, vp=<value optimized out>,
    flags=<value optimized out>) at jsinterp.c:1303




Before going the bugzilla route I would like to know if some of you is
experiencing the same but also opinions about why nspluginwrapper is
not protecting me from that...

TIA

Gianluca




More information about the fedora-devel-list mailing list